Perceived neighborhood problems are associated with shorter telomere length in African American women
OBJECTIVES: African Americans (AA) experience higher levels of stress related to living in racially segregated and poor neighborhoods. However, little is known about the associations between perceived neighborhood environments and cellular aging among adult AA. This study examined whether perceived...
